Caring Week of 3/11/12

This week's theme is caring.  We are learning about the importance of caring about others. 
We are looking at James 1:27 which says that real religion is caring about orphans and widows and keeping from being polluted by the world.  This simply means that rather than doing our best to appear religious, our actions should show what we really believe. 

Another bible verse that we will study is John 3:16.  This is a very often memorized and quoted verse that says that God loved the world so much that he sent Jesus so that our sins could be payed for.  This is important because if Jesus cared enough for us to leave heaven and come to us, we should care about others enough to leave our comfort zone and minister to them. 

In children's church we will be looking at the story of Jesus raising Lazarus from the dead.  This story can be found in John 11.  This story tells a lot about Jesus.  First off, in the story Jesus knows that Lazarus is going to die and that he is going to bring him back.  This is a great example of Jesus' divinity.  We also see Jesus weeping even though he knew that Lazarus was going to come back.  What a great example of his humanity!  He felt sadness even though he knew it would be ok!  More than anything, this story tells us about Jesus' heart.  He really cared for Lazarus and all the people mourning his death.  While it is doubtful that God is going to use us to raise people's loved ones from the dead, we can care as Jesus did.  We can be there when people are hurting. 

This week, talk to your kids about practical ways that they can care about those hurting around us.
